Names and origin
| Protein names | Recommended name: Malate dehydrogenase, mitochondrial EC=1.1.1.37 |
| Organism | Schistosoma mansoni (Blood fluke) |
| Taxonomic identifier | 6183 [NCBI] |
| Taxonomic lineage | Eukaryota › Metazoa › Platyhelminthes › Trematoda › Digenea › Strigeidida › Schistosomatoidea › Schistosomatidae › Schistosoma |
Protein attributes
| Sequence length | 142 AA. |
| Sequence status | Fragment. |
| Sequence processing | The displayed sequence is not processed. |
| Protein existence | Evidence at transcript level. |
General annotation (Comments)
| Catalytic activity | (S)-malate + NAD+ = oxaloacetate + NADH. |
| Subunit structure | Homodimer By similarity. |
| Subcellular location | |
| Developmental stage | Expressed in relatively high level in adults as compared to larval worms. |
| Sequence similarities | Belongs to the LDH/MDH superfamily. MDH type 1 family. |
